  5. Pilipinas Kay Ganda -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pilipinas_Kay_Ganda

    The tourism slogan and the associated logo used for the campaign were controversial and received mostly negative reception from the Filipino public, even leading to the resignation of the country's then-Tourism Secretary, Alberto Lim. Pilipinas Kay Ganda was eventually replaced, in 2012, with "It's More Fun in the Philippines!". [1] [2]

  9. Presidency of Bongbong Marcos -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Presidency_of_Bongbong_Marcos

    In June 2023, the Marcos administration's tourism department launched a new branding campaign worth ₱ 49 million; it included a new tourism slogan "Love the Philippines" which replaced the decade-old "It's More Fun in the Philippines". The tourism department contracted a creative agency, DDB Philippines, to produce a campaign video.
